Not sure if you're looking for a baked New York style cheesecake if you are, this is the one I make www.bbcgoodfood.com/recipes/new-york-cheesecake

I always add a few extra biscuits for the base and about 5g extra butter. It's very high in calories and with only two of us at home I have to freeze it in slices to stop me eating half of it in one sitting.
